The Wallabies: the nickname dates back to Australia's first rugby tour of the United Kingdom. The British press tried to dub the Australians the "Rabbits". Not wanting to be characterised as pests (as rabbits are considered there), the Australians responded by choosing a marsupial native to their country as their emblem: the wallaby.
